Description ▲
Serendipity - value creation based on unexpected encounters - is a new trend in the world of business. Successful global players like Google and LinkedIn are introducing serendipity leaves for their employees: time they can spend outside of rigid work structure in order to find value in the most surprising places. These companies know how important unexpected encounters and knowledge exchange are for innovation. But what if it is actually possible to build a business - a machine - that systematically facilitates serendipity? This book presents a disruptive business model that is able to do exactly that. It shows how the Dutch company Seats2meet.com became a Serendipity Machine by implementing principles of asynchronous reciprocity, social capital and third space. The book explains these principles, providing companies and organizations with the insight they need to start their own transformation into Serendipity Machines.
